Summary:A hybrid projector architecture combines steered light with unsteered light. In some embodiments the steered light is narrowband light and the unsteered light is broadband light. Splitting between thesteered and unsteered light may be determined based on luminance level. For example, the unsteered light may contribute a large proportion of the light for luminance levels up to a threshold. The steered light may contribute an increasing proportion of the light as luminance values rise above the threshold. 一种混合投影仪架构将转向光与非转向光组合。在一些实施方式中,转向光是窄带光而非转向光是宽带光。可以基于亮度水平来确定转向光与非转向光之间的划分。例如,非转向光会贡献大比例的上至阈值的亮度水平的光。随着亮度值上升超过阈值,转向光会贡献增加比例的光。
